study guides for every class

that actually explain what's on your next test

Quantum bits (qubits)

from class:

Intro to Nanotechnology

Definition

Quantum bits, or qubits, are the fundamental units of information in quantum computing, analogous to classical bits in traditional computing. Unlike classical bits that can only represent a state of 0 or 1, qubits can exist in superpositions of states, allowing them to represent both 0 and 1 simultaneously. This unique property enables quantum computers to perform complex calculations much faster than their classical counterparts.

congrats on reading the definition of quantum bits (qubits). now let's actually learn it.

ok, let's learn stuff

5 Must Know Facts For Your Next Test

  1. Qubits can be implemented using various physical systems, including photons, trapped ions, and superconducting circuits, each with its own advantages and challenges.
  2. The ability of qubits to exist in superpositions allows quantum computers to process vast amounts of information simultaneously, leading to potential exponential speedups for specific problems.
  3. Decoherence is a major challenge for qubit stability, as interactions with the environment can disrupt the delicate quantum states that qubits rely on.
  4. Quantum algorithms such as Shor's and Grover's take advantage of qubit properties to solve problems like factoring large numbers and searching unsorted databases more efficiently than classical algorithms.
  5. Qubit technology is still in its early stages, with ongoing research aimed at increasing coherence times and error rates to make quantum computing more practical for real-world applications.

Review Questions

  • How do the properties of qubits enable them to outperform classical bits in computing?
    • Qubits possess unique properties like superposition and entanglement that allow them to perform complex calculations simultaneously. While classical bits can only represent either 0 or 1 at a time, qubits can represent both states due to superposition. This means that a quantum computer can explore multiple solutions at once, significantly speeding up problem-solving processes compared to classical computing.
  • Discuss the challenges associated with maintaining qubit stability and how they impact quantum computing.
    • Maintaining qubit stability is critical for effective quantum computing due to phenomena like decoherence, which occurs when qubits interact with their environment. This interaction can cause the loss of information encoded in the qubits, leading to errors in computations. Researchers are actively working on techniques to isolate qubits from environmental interference and enhance coherence times to improve the reliability of quantum computations.
  • Evaluate the implications of qubit technology advancements on future computational capabilities and potential applications.
    • Advancements in qubit technology promise to revolutionize computational capabilities by enabling quantum computers to solve complex problems that are currently intractable for classical computers. With improved coherence times and reduced error rates, practical applications could emerge in fields such as cryptography, drug discovery, and optimization problems. As these technologies mature, they have the potential to reshape industries by providing unprecedented processing power and insights into complex systems.
ยฉ 2024 Fiveable Inc. All rights reserved.
APยฎ and SATยฎ are trademarks registered by the College Board, which is not affiliated with, and does not endorse this website.